CSS中的长度单位
2015-07-29 11:29
633 查看
CSS中,长度单位有两种,分别是绝对长度单位和相对长度单位。
绝对长度单位
绝对长度单位分为in(英寸)、cm(厘米)、mm(毫米)、pt(磅)、pc(pica)。其中,in(英寸)、cm(厘米)、mm(毫米)和实际中常用的单位完全相同。重点介绍一下pt(磅)、pc(pica)。
pt(磅):是标准印刷上常用的单位,72pt的长度为1英寸。
pc(pica):这也是一个印刷上用的单位,1pc的长度为12磅。
绝对长度单位,虽然理解起来很容易,但是在网页的设计中很少用到。
相对长度单位
相对长度单位是使用最多的长度单位。包括em、ex、px,下面分别介绍一下。
em是定义文字大小的值,也就是文本中font-size属性的值。例如:定义某个元素的文字大小为12pt,那么,对于这个元素来说1em就是12pt。单位em的实际大小是受到字体尺寸的影响的。
ex和em类似,指的是文本中字母x的高度,因为不同的字体的x的高度是不同的,所以ex的实际大小,受到字体和字体尺寸两个因素的影响。
px就是通常所说的像素,使网页设计中使用最多的长度单位。将显示器分成非常细小的方格,每个方格就是一个像素。表面上看好像很容易理解,实际上,px的具体大小是受到屏幕的分辨率影响的,也就是和划分屏幕各自的方式有关。例如,同样是100px大小的字体,如果显示器使用800×600像素的分辨率,那么,每个字的宽度是屏幕的1/8。若将显示器的分辨率设置为1024×768像素,那么同样是100px字体的字,其宽度就越为屏幕宽度的1
/10。
绝对长度单位
绝对长度单位分为in(英寸)、cm(厘米)、mm(毫米)、pt(磅)、pc(pica)。其中,in(英寸)、cm(厘米)、mm(毫米)和实际中常用的单位完全相同。重点介绍一下pt(磅)、pc(pica)。
pt(磅):是标准印刷上常用的单位,72pt的长度为1英寸。
pc(pica):这也是一个印刷上用的单位,1pc的长度为12磅。
绝对长度单位,虽然理解起来很容易,但是在网页的设计中很少用到。
相对长度单位
相对长度单位是使用最多的长度单位。包括em、ex、px,下面分别介绍一下。
em是定义文字大小的值,也就是文本中font-size属性的值。例如:定义某个元素的文字大小为12pt,那么,对于这个元素来说1em就是12pt。单位em的实际大小是受到字体尺寸的影响的。
ex和em类似,指的是文本中字母x的高度,因为不同的字体的x的高度是不同的,所以ex的实际大小,受到字体和字体尺寸两个因素的影响。
px就是通常所说的像素,使网页设计中使用最多的长度单位。将显示器分成非常细小的方格,每个方格就是一个像素。表面上看好像很容易理解,实际上,px的具体大小是受到屏幕的分辨率影响的,也就是和划分屏幕各自的方式有关。例如,同样是100px大小的字体,如果显示器使用800×600像素的分辨率,那么,每个字的宽度是屏幕的1/8。若将显示器的分辨率设置为1024×768像素,那么同样是100px字体的字,其宽度就越为屏幕宽度的1
/10。
相关文章推荐
- CSS中让一个div的高度随着另外个一个统计的div的高度变化而变化的代码
- CSS中让一个div的高度随着另外个一个统计的div的高度变化而变化的代码
- Grunt 进行js,css文件合并,压缩
- Js 动态插入css js文件
- QTableView的滚动条设置样式
- php使用gzip压缩传输js和css文件的方法
- 纯CSS绘制三角形(各种角度)
- CSS实现不固定宽度和高度的自动居中
- 纯CSS3浮雕质感的立体文字旋转动画
- Java Web项目中CSS路径的问题
- CSS3 transition的使用
- DOM 操作表格及样式
- CSS中的 backgroundPosition 属性
- CSS-小谈LV,HA!
- 如何使用CSS3画出一个叮当猫
- css的伪类别
- 全局CSS样式
- 如何使用CSS3画出一个叮当猫
- php使用gzip压缩传输js和css文件的方法
- Symfony2安装时欢迎页面CSS混乱的解决方案